Mr. Niall Byrne:

We are carefully looking at our revenue projections for next year and we are not predicting a dramatic increase in revenue for next year. We think it will be fairly stable year on year but there are some uncertainties on the revenue side because of changes that have come in relating to the registration of tenancies. This is part of what we are trying to convey to the committee and I hope it is coming across in the genuine way in which it is intended. We are in a period at the moment where, for various reasons, it is quite tricky for the RTB on the data side to look at our income, given the changes to the registration requirements, changes in legislation and the introduction of the moratorium. All those issues have a significant impact for us. Obviously, we are much more concerned about the impact for broader society, but within the organisation, all those aspects are creating a lot of issues, all of which have to be managed, with priorities to be shaped around them-----
